    Popped the question with a token ring over Christmas. We're going to Dubai in March and have been doing a bit of research and seems to be great value based on some old threads on here.

    Just looking to see if anyone on here has any recent experiences? Budget is probably around the €3k mark. Cara seems to be the main place that was mentioned in older threads.

    Congrats! Cara is still very popular and always comes highly recommended. It's always extremely busy. I prefer and have used Monili a few times. The main guy is Vipul. I would go to both and see what prices you get. Unfortunately the euro being rubbish at the moment means it's not as good value as before but still better than home. Both shops are in the gold and diamond park (a jewelry mall). If you know what diamond and design you are after it should only take a few days to have it made.

    I would second Cara's. I bought wedding rings off them last year and the service and contact via email was great. Maybe give the a shout before you head over so you have the ball rolling. They also have a car service and you can arrange them to pick you up etc
